Market dynamics and near‑term catalysts
Feedstock cost structure: International coconut oil prices in 2026 have averaged in the USD 2,000–2,300 per metric ton band, remaining elevated relative to pre‑pandemic baseline levels. Specific pricing in origin markets (e.g., Philippines/Indonesia) has at times reached roughly USD 2,259/mt—reflecting weather impacts and sustained food and cosmetic demand. These inputs materially affect CME margin profiles and encourage manufacturers to explore yield‑enhancing processing and vertical integration.
Regulatory drivers: In the Philippines the diesel pool retains a mandatory coconut methyl ester blend at 3%, with authorities reviewing staged increases. Policymakers have publicly resisted replacing domestic CME with imported palm methyl ester, signaling continued policy support for local production. Such national policy choices continue to be a decisive volume driver for regional players and a point of contention for trade and procurement strategies.
Supply chain tightness and weather: Concentration of copra supply in select geographies creates weather‑linked production variability. Firms with near‑term exposure to procurement risk should model scenarios where seasonal shortfalls persist for multiple quarters.
Competitive landscape: strategic positions and implications
The market shows moderate concentration: the three largest firms account for a meaningful share of global supply, and the top five concentrate a clear majority of volume—creating a market where leading players can influence price and product specification norms, but where niche and regional players retain room to compete on specialty grades and service.
Wilmar International (Singapore) — Scale and feedstock integration: With extensive oleochemical capacity in Southeast Asia and capabilities to offer both broad‑cut and distilled methyl esters, Wilmar is positioned to defend commodity‑grade volumes and to push technical specifications into regional supply contracts.
Tantuco Enterprises (Philippines) — Vertical integration advantage: Owning oil mills and producing RBD coconut oil alongside CME gives Tantuco a supply advantage for domestic biodiesel mandates and creates optionality for forward contracting.
Stepan Company (United States) — Formulation and specialty focus: With marketed grades tailored for solvents and specialty applications, Stepan exemplifies the value chain move toward higher‑margin, application‑specific methyl esters.
Oleon NV (Belgium), Covalent Chemical (USA), Parchem (USA) — Niche and distribution plays: These firms leverage formulation expertise, global distribution networks, and specification control (e.g., FFA, color limits) to serve personal care, coatings, and industrial markets where traceability and consistency trade at a premium.
